The Robert Redford Building for NRDC – Santa Monica, California
Project: Robert Redford Building for The National Resource Defense Council
Address: 1314 2nd St, Santa Monica, CA 90401
Architect: Moule and Polyzoides
Structural Engineer: Nabih Youssef & Associates
Sustainability Engineers: Syska Hennessy Group
Greywater System Design and Installation: Environmental Planning & Design, LLC
Solar Consultant: Solar Design Associates
General Contractor: TG Construction Inc.
Project Manager: Tishman Construction Corporation of California
LEED Coordinator: CTG Energetics
Size: 15,000 sf
Completed: November 2003
Cost: $ 3.9 Million
AE Interest: First building in the US to achieve LEED Platinum [a]. 90% recycled or recyclable construction materials [b]. Combined on-site grey water and storm water collection used to fill toilets and landscape irrigation [c]. 7.5 kW rooftop solar electric array provides 20% of the building’s power [d]. Remaining energy needs filled by purchasing renewable energy credits, occupant controlled ventilation, lighting, and temperature [e].
